Cycle path hazardous - dangerous to users

Reported via desktop in the Suggested improvements category anonymously at 11:33, Monday 12 June 2023

Sent to Oxfordshire County Council less than a minute later

Less than 50% of the width of the cycle path is actually accessible due to lack of maintenance of vegetation, which must be removed to ensure the full width of the path (exposing the concrete edging at both edges of the path) is accessible. The resurfacing of the road has caused the chippings to cover the path thus moving the skid hazard from the road to the path, the stone chippings need to be cleared.
